It's sad to see that, Solway CPC have the six billion pounds of funding lined up - ready to commit now to building Rolls-Royce SMR in West Cumbria, with a clear strategy on social value and giving back to the community. But the Government is centralising decisions on a new, more flexible and investable technology via Great British Nuclear who are developing a 'process' similar to that for large scale nuclear. The Nuclear Minister Andrew Bowie was off in the USA talking about fusion this week (always many years away) and Rishi Sunak seems completely oblivious to the great work being done in West Cumbria. The greatest hold-up to unlocking SMR's in the UK is the Government itself... As my rant of the week has been - we seem obsessed with having a process in this country, whether you're dealing with the NHS, your council or even most large private companies. People only seem to care that a process is followed, there's no regard for the outcome or what most people would view as common sense... Cumberland Council #nuclear #smr #cumbria

Fort Bliss in Texas is one of the largest U.S. military bases, covering about 1,700 square miles. Home to the U.S. Army’s 1st Armored Division, it is also a site for the Pentagon’s efforts to develop clean energy generation and microgrids for delivering electricity at its installations. Sage Geosystems Inc., a Houston-based developer of geothermal energy and storage technologies, has a Department of Defense contract to examine the feasibility of installing a geothermal power system for Ft. Bliss. The U.S. Army Climate Strategy has a target of reducing greenhouse gasses from its facilities by 50% by 2030 (with a net-zero goal by 2050) and installing a microgrid on every base by 2035 in order to enhance energy security.
